The Traffic Coordinator schedules, assigns, and directs drivers and vehicles to transport steel/products and coordinates drivers according to customer requests in compliance with DOT regulations and company rules.

Responsibilities
  • Communicates with sales/customers to determine driver’s needs and schedules and notifies drivers of assignments; enters assignment data in computer database.
  • Monitors daily and promptly addresses critical safety issues and maintenance issues.
  • Daily routing and route compliance with deliveries and pick-ups.
  • Monitors driver compliance regulations with DOT and Company policies (physically inspect equipment daily).
  • Assigns and directs drivers each day, maintain fleet equipment maintenance.
  • Screens drivers on a daily basis using Alert Meter to ensure they are reporting to work physically and mentally prepared for work; completes reasonable suspicion evaluation when necessary.
  • Adjusts schedule accordingly due to absenteeism, equipment breakdown, and common carrier hiring.
  • Negotiates rates, builds new carrier contacts with contract carriers and ensures their equipment meets DOT standards.
  • Supervises/assigns/routes equipment service providers when needed.
  • Monitors E-LOGS and DVIRs (current system JJ KELLER-Encompass) to maintain DOT compliance.
  • Sets up and coordinates all hot shots.
  • Maintains equipment maintenance/registration and internal driver qualification files.
